Corn operates in a light fall at CBOT

At 2:46 pm (Brasília time), this Friday (15), the March contract fell 2.50 points and 0.47% on the Chicago Stock Exchange (CBOT), traded at US$ cents 531.75 / bushel. May fell 2.50 points and 0.46%, at $ cents 535.25 / bushel. The market follows the technical movements of realizing profits after highs the day before, in addition to advances in the planting of corn 2020/21 in Argentina and the return of rains in the country's agricultural areas. The Argentine Ministry of Agriculture, Livestock and Fisheries released today in its weekly report data on the planting work for the new harvest, which increased to 91% of the total by January 14, 4 percentage points above the previous week. In addition, there is caution about global demand, mainly from China, with the lack of daily purchases above 100 thousand tons made in this last session of the week.
